My personal opinion on selling untested f1 seed is mixed. When someone is very familiarwith the female they grow, knowing stress triggers ect., maybe grown a few different hybrids of hers, one can gage whether or not, with a fair amount of certainty there will be little to no issues (with say intersex traits). I do not prefer to sell untested seed stock, but I have and will continue to do so.
as for whatever else is going on with cuts given, words spoken, I have no idea. If you give your word, keep it. If given a gift use it.

Good evening fellow cultivators. For any of you growing out Elephant Stomper x Stardawg - IF you plan on mainlining, DEFINITELY make your cut at the 3rd node as I'm observing that these seem to naturally start alternating at/after the 5th node...(the 3 N.OG'S that I havent topped are still symmetrical and Im at the 6-7th node on those)...I do realize this is normal as some plants stay symmetrical up to a point and some go alternating early....this is just a heads up.....happy cultivating.
